Comparing this 2.03 carat sapphire to more common lower weight stones clarifies its advantage in visual impact and versatility. Sapphires in the one carat range often appear delicate on the finger, requiring a heavier or more intricate setting to achieve the same visual weight that a two carat gem provides naturally. Conversely, larger stones that reach three carats or more can sometimes carry uneven color zoning or require more extensive cutting compromises, which can mute brilliance. This Tanzanian sapphire sits in an ideal zone where carat weight, dimensions, cut, and polish work together to create immediate presence, balanced proportions, and impressive light performance. The mixed brilliant cut enhances sparkle relative to standard step or modified cuts, so the eye perceives more scintillation even though the gem maintains the generous, deep blue saturation that collectors and connoisseurs prize.
Clarity and treatment are the other pivotal comparators in establishing superiority. Evaluated at eye level as slightly included, this sapphire reads effectively eye clean owing to its transparency and strategic cutting, meaning typical observers will experience uninterrupted color and sparkle. Many market stones with similar face up color rely on heat treatment, clarity enhancement, or diffusion to achieve that look, and those treatments can alter long term appearance and market value. An unenhanced natural sapphire of vivid color at 2.03 carats is relatively rare and therefore more desirable for someone seeking authenticity and longevity. Origin matters as well, and Tanzanian sapphires have gained a reputation for rich, saturated tones and strong clarity in certain mines, offering a distinct profile from stones that originate elsewhere.
